Beginning in December 2007, the U. S. economy experienced a severe economic recession that resulted in high unemployment, declines in personal and family income, collapse of the housing market, and more Americans living in poverty. There was also an increase in small business failures, plant closings, a greater reliance on government as a safety net for survival, and more individuals reporting mental and emotional distress. Other economic challenges experienced in the nation include financial instability, and reductions in economic output, business climate, and consumer confidence etc. The aforementioned hardships and difficulties experienced in the nation, and the resulting discomfort in individuals' lives have impacted every racial ethnic, religious, political, and socioeconomic group. This book, God's Provision During Economic Difficulty, asserts that God is the ultimate answer to the economic problems faced by individuals and the nation. God should be petitioned through fasting, prayer and obedience to His word to deliver the country out of its economic malaise. God promises of deliverance are certain for those who follow Him. Leaving God out of the solution to the economic challenges confronting individuals and the nation will prolong the discomfort associated with the economic decline. God's Provision During Economic Difficulty utilizes a case-study approach to examine some of the economic challenges confronting Old and New Testament saints. This approach explores how God met the economic needs of Job, Abraham, Ruth, David, Elijah, Nehemiah and the nation of Israel based on direct scriptural references, and the biblical confirmation of His provision. God's ways of handling economic difficulties are sure, available, and well documented. The faithful today should exhibit the personal faith and commitment of earlier believers to obviate the economic challenges facing them and the nation. Job, Abraham, Ruth, David, Elijah, Nehemiah, the nation of Israel, and other saints are selected because of the poignant lessons they convey to Christians today on how God operates during difficult economic circumstances. They exemplify God's deliverance during economic difficulties and protracted hardship. Examining how God delivered the faithful during economic difficulties will provide hope, confidence and faith in Him during the economic crises. God's ways of handling situations, including economic hardships, are different that man's ways. The world's view of the appropriate individual and national response to economic emergencies is inadequate to offer any real hope, comfort, and direction.
